This profile is meant to be completed by the student, not the parent or guardian. JVA is designated as an Alternative Education Campus (AEC) by the Colorado Department of Education (CDE). This designation requires that a percentage of our students fall into at least one of the at-risk categories and helps us meet the needs of JVA students. Questions in this application help determine the programming needed to best serve our students. Contact [email protected] if you did not receive the email with the link to the survey.
Admission into JVA is in no way tied to students having any at-risk factors. This information helps us serve students and families and all information remains confidential and will only be used to support student success.

Our only fee, per the district, is an annual Technology Fee. All full-time students (with the exception of 5th, 6th, 7th, 9th, 10, and 11th grade students) have a $25 fee. All full-time 5th, 6th, 7th, 9th, 10th and 11th graders have a fee of $50 because they are provided a Chromebook as part of the 1:1 Technology for Education program.
